Pricing: When I joined FSS around 6 years ago there were two options available and I'm sure that is still the case. The more expensive includes a service where they list your property on various sites throughout the world, the cheaper one (the one I opted for) being solely for the use of their availability and booking system. Last year I paid just over £200 for 12 months.

There is regular contact regarding updates and the staff are well informed and extremely helpful on the rare occasions when a problem occurs. I very much doubt that there would be a visit by a rep - it's a very small company based in the Oxfordshire Cotswolds and I have certainly never had such a visit. When I made my initial enquiry I was given disks with interactive demos and a lot of general info including screenshots. Problems are speedily resolved via Gast pc visits.
